Trip Planning
Trip Planning Tourist Attractions Restaurants Bed and Breakfast Inns Campgrounds

Russia Luxury Hotels - Hotel Rooms

 Asia Hotels   Tourist Attraction Search   Restaurant Search   B&B Search   Campground Search 
 Russia Tourist Attractions
 Russia Restaurants
send to a friend

Russia Luxury Hotels and Hotel Destinations

Russia

The Russia Luxury hotels listed on this page and in the following destinations are hotels that have luxury hotel room rates and prices. You can compare hotel prices by checking the availability of the luxury hotel rooms. Below you'll find Russia Luxury hotel travel and vacation destinations. Click the links to drill into a specific destination or use our Hotel Vacation Destination Search to find your next vacation destination fast.

Our Hotel Search offers the most sophisticated way to find hotel rooms from over 70,000 hotels around the world. Search by hotel, price range, rating, and even amenities. Give it a try and make your next hotel reservation with WhenWeTravel!

Featured Russia Luxury Hotels

Hotel Picture Hotel Name Hotel Type Rating Best Price* High Price* Description Check Availability
Ukraina Hotel Moscow Moscow Ukraina Hotel Moscow Luxury 5 Star Rated $15,481.70 $35,186.30 Located in Moscows City centre the Radisson Royal Hotel Moscow sits on a bend of the Moskva River at the intersection of Kutuzovskiy Prospekt and Novy Check Availability
Metropol Hotel Moscow Moscow Metropol Hotel Moscow Luxury Not Rated $10,450.00 $47,800.00 The Metropol Hotel is one of the oldest hotels in Moscow and was open in 1901 (renovated in 1991). The hotel is located in the city centre close to Bolshoi Check Availability
Hotel Baltschug Kempinski Moscow Moscow Hotel Baltschug Kempinski Moscow Luxury 4 Star Rated $12,600.00 $90,000.00 This award winning hotel is regarded as one of the most prestigious in the country as it was one of the first international branded hotels to open in the Check Availability
Savoy Hotel Moscow Moscow Savoy Hotel Moscow Luxury Not Rated $10,700.00 $101,700.00 Reflecting the Moscow lifestyle this city hotel combines gracious traditions with state-of-the-art guest room amenities. After being extensively restored Check Availability
Lotte Hotel Moscow Moscow Lotte Hotel Moscow Luxury 5 Star Rated $15,000.00 $275,000.00 Built in 2010 the city hotel has a total of 304 guest rooms. The hotel guarantees its guests comfort in an elegant atmosphere. The premises are air-conditioned Check Availability
Hotel Picture Hotel Name Hotel Type Rating Best Price* High Price* Description Check Availability
Taleon Imperial Hotel Saint Petersburg Taleon Imperial Hotel Luxury 5 Star Rated The Taleon Imperial Hotel’s superb location in the heart of St. Petersburg’s historical and business center makes it ideal for guests who find the famous Check Availability

* Prices available within the next two weeks
 
send to a friend
 
Advertisements